Manitoba Transportation and Infrastructure is seeking engineering services for a hydrodynamic modelling study of Sturgeon Creek to support flood risk management in the Parklands region. - Government Buyer: - Manitoba Transportation and Infrastructure, Water Management Planning and Standards - Contracting office: 2nd Floor, 280 Broadway, Winnipeg, MB R3C 0R8 - Requested Services: - Provision of a 2D hydrodynamic modelling study for Sturgeon Creek - Use of HEC-RAS 2D software to simulate flood events up to a 1-in-500-year flood - Includes data review, site visit, model calibration and validation, flood scenario runs, and flood hazard mapping - Flood hazard maps required for rural stretches and four communities: Sturgeon Creek Hutterite Colony, Woodlands, Warren, and Winnipeg - Reporting of impacted properties by flood event - Unique/Notable Requirements: - Indigenous business participation is encouraged and will be scored - No specific OEMs or vendors are mandated; HEC-RAS 2D software is specified for modelling - Period of Performance: - 10 months with an option for an additional 2 months - Place of Performance: - Parklands region, Manitoba, including Sturgeon Creek Hutterite Colony, Woodlands, Warren, and Winnipeg - Contracting office in Winnipeg, MB

The Government of Manitoba, represented by the Minister of Manitoba Transportation and Infrastructure, is issuing a Request for Proposals (RFP) for the provision of a hydrodynamic modelling study for Sturgeon Creek. The project involves engineering services to conduct the study over a duration of 10 months with an option for an additional 2 months. The study aims to support water management planning and standards in the Parklands region of Manitoba, Canada.
